Why a summit dedicated to physical AI today?
For several years, the debate around artificial intelligence has focused almost exclusively on language models and software applications. The launch of the MACHINA Summit marks an inflection: the event intends to explore the way in which AI moves from software to machines and systems, from robotics to autonomy, with the conviction that the future is taking shape now both in the factory and in the data center.
Organized on July 7, 2026 in Paris, to open the week which will also see the RAISE Summit being held on July 8 and 9, MACHINA is aimed at a targeted audience: industrial leaders, roboticists, investors specializing in deep tech and public decision-makers faced with automation challenges. This calendar proximity with RAISE is not trivial: it allows the two summits to share a base ofspeakers and capture a common audience of leaders shaping the future of artificial intelligenceaccording to the organizers.

Robotics, autonomy and investment: what MACHINA can change for the tech ecosystem
The arrival of a summit dedicated to physical AI is part of a broader dynamic driven by Chain Of Eventsthe organizer of the RAISE Summit, which structures the two events as two complementary sides of the same transformation. On the one hand, RAISE covers market fundamentals of software AI through its four tracks Foundation, Frontier, Friction and Future. On the other hand, MACHINA is positioning itself in a segment that is still little covered by major European conferences: the integration of AI into mechanical and autonomous systems capable of interacting directly with their environment.
For the institutional investors in search of new growth drivers beyond the already strained valuations of generative AI, this shift towards physical AI could represent an area of opportunity that is still under-exploited. Industrial robotics, autonomous logistics and embedded systems are among the sectors likely to benefit from accelerated investment as the costs of sensors and embedded computing continue to fall.
